HR Hosts Workshop on Attendance System
To enhance awareness of administrative systems and improve the institutional work environment, the Human Resources Department organised an introductory workshop on the Attendance System. The event was held in Lecture Hall (1) and drew notable participation, with more than 300 attendees representing academic, administrative and technical staff.
The workshop aimed to provide a comprehensive explanation of the system and how it operates, while also clarifying the main regulations and procedures associated with its implementation. This initiative sought to strengthen staff members’ understanding of the system’s provisions and support its effective application within the workplace.
During the session, representatives from the Human Resources Department presented key statistics related to the Attendance System. They also outlined the regulations governing the system and the procedures followed in its implementation.
The workshop witnessed considerable engagement from participants. At the conclusion of the session, the floor was opened for questions and enquiries, which were addressed in detail to help clarify the various aspects related to the system.
